#aedd93 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#aedd93 is composed of 68.2% red, 86.7% green and 57.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 21.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 33.5% yellow and 13.3% black. It has a hue angle of 98.1 degrees, a saturation of 52.1% and a lightness of 72.2%. #aedd93 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#5dbb27. Closest websafe color is: #99cc99.

Shades and Tints of #aedd93

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060b04 is the darkest color, while #fcfefb is the lightest one.

Tones of #aedd93

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#b7bcb4 is the less saturated color, while #a5fe72 is the most saturated one.
